Malfunction Operation
If the vehicle stalls whilst
driving
1. Reduce your speed and keep straight.
2. Stop the vehicle in a safe place.
3. Turn the hazard warning flasher on.
4. Restart the vehicle.
If the vehicle stalls at a
crossroad or crossing
1. Shift to N (Neutral).
2. Push the vehicle to a safe place.
If you have a flat tyre whilst
driving
1. Reduce your speed slowly and keep straight.
2. Stop the vehicle in a safe, level place away from traffic.
3. Turn the hazard warning flasher on.
4. Set the parking brake.
5. Shift to P (Park).
6. Have all passengers get out of the vehicle and move away
from traffic.

If the vehicle will not start
• Be sure P (Park) gear position is selected. The vehicle starts
only when P (Park) gear position is selected.
• Check the 12-volt battery connections to be sure they are
clean and tight.
• Turn on the interior light. If the light dims or goes out when
you operate the starter, the 12V battery is drained.
